About EATON

Eaton Corporation plc is a multinational power management company with 2020 sales of $17.9 billion, founded in the US. Eaton provides energy-efficient solutions that help customers effectively manage electrical, hydraulic, and mechanical power more efficiently, safely, and sustainably. Eaton operates through three main business segments: Electrical Products, Electrical Systems and Services, and Hydraulics. The Electrical Products segment designs, manufactures, markets, and sells electrical components, such as circuit breakers, switches, and electrical protection and control devices. The Electrical Systems and Services segment offers electrical power distribution and assemblies, as well as engineering services and automation and control solutions. The Hydraulics segment provides products such as pumps, motors, valves, cylinders, and filtration products. Eaton has a global presence with operations in North America, Europe, Asia, and other regions.
